Recessions are NBER's US business-cycle dates. That is why the two most-quoted cases come out as misses here: Petronas in 1998 is paired with the Asian financial crisis and Burj Khalifa in 2010 with Dubai's debt crisis, and neither is a US recession. If the index describes a global phenomenon, one national yardstick is a limitation; measured against that yardstick, those two cases are not evidence for it.
The gap is measured to the start of a recession. The index's claim is that record height leads a turning point, so a tower finished in the middle of a slump already under way is not evidence for it. The Empire State Building in 1931 is the clearest case: it did not foreshadow the Depression, it opened into one, and the table shows it that way.
Completion is dated to mid-year because the source list is annual. A window of twelve months either side is wide enough that this approximation cannot flip a result on its own, but these numbers do not support reading a month or two as meaningful.
Above all, the sample is fourteen. A coincidence rate near half is indistinguishable from a coin flip at that size. Barr, Mizrach and Mundra (Rutgers, 2015) likewise found no evidence that record completions lead the cycle. Tall building and economic activity do move together, but because credit loosening drives both — not because one announces the other.
It is the name given to the observation that economies tend to break down around the time the world's tallest building is completed. The analyst Andrew Lawrence coined it in 1999, and it has been re-quoted at every crisis since, usually as a curse. The cases raised most often are the Empire State Building and the Depression in 1931, the Petronas Towers and the Asian financial crisis in 1998, and Burj Khalifa and Dubai's debt crisis in 2010. It is less an index that computes a value than a story assembled from examples.
Record-breaking towers are usually conceived when credit is at its loosest, because that is when borrowing is easy and demand for space looks endless enough for a tallest-in-the-world plan to get signed off. Those buildings then take roughly five years to build. So the ribbon-cutting often lands after that optimism has already cooled. The pattern comes from the credit conditions at groundbreaking and a long construction period, not from height causing anything.
It sets the completion year of all fourteen buildings that have held the world's-tallest record since 1890 against the US recessions dated by the National Bureau of Economic Research. The recession bands are built from the USREC series at the St. Louis Fed's FRED, grouping consecutive months, and each building gets the gap in months to the nearest recession start. Buildings that land within twelve months either side are marked in the table. It is not a forecasting screen; it puts the claim and the record side by side.
